J. Preston–Thomas is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Automotive Engineering and Mechanical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, J. Preston–Thomas has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 383 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ering, 4 papers in Automotive Engineering and 4 papers in Mechanical Engineering. Recurrent topics in J. Preston–Thomas's work include Soil Mechanics and Vehicle Dynamics (12 papers), Transportation Safety and Impact Analysis (6 papers) and Vehicle Dynamics and Control Systems (3 papers). J. Preston–Thomas is often cited by papers focused on Soil Mechanics and Vehicle Dynamics (12 papers), Transportation Safety and Impact Analysis (6 papers) and Vehicle Dynamics and Control Systems (3 papers). J. Preston–Thomas collaborates with scholars based in Canada and United States. J. Preston–Thomas's co-authors include J.Y. Wong, Michael D. Garber, Paramsothy Jayakumar, Jo Yung Wong, Moustafa El–Gindy and Sally Shoop and has published in prestigious journals such as SAE technical papers on CD-ROM/SAE technical paper series, Proceedings of the Institution of Mechanical Engineers Part D Journal of Automobile Engineering and Journal of Terramechanics.
